云计算作为信息技术发展的一个重要趋势,正在深刻地改变着企业的IT架构和运营模式。随着技术的不断进步,云计算的研究方向也在不断拓展,既带来了新的创新机遇,也伴随着一系列挑战。本文将深入探讨云计算当前的研究方向,分析其中的创新点,以及面临的挑战。

一、云计算的研究方向

1. 弹性计算

弹性计算是云计算的核心之一,它允许用户根据需求动态地调整计算资源。研究方向包括:

  • 资源调度算法:研究如何更高效地分配和调度计算资源,以优化性能和成本。
  • 容器技术:如Docker和Kubernetes,它们提供了轻量级、可移植的计算环境,有助于提高资源利用率。

2. 云安全

随着云计算的普及,安全问题日益凸显。研究方向包括:

  • 加密技术:研究新的加密算法和密钥管理方法,以保护数据安全。
  • 安全协议:开发新的安全协议,以防止数据泄露和非法访问。

3. 软件定义网络(SDN)

SDN通过集中控制网络流量,提高了网络的可编程性和灵活性。研究方向包括:

  • 网络虚拟化:实现网络资源的虚拟化,以支持多租户环境。
  • 网络功能虚拟化:将传统的网络功能(如防火墙、负载均衡器)虚拟化,以降低成本。

4. 大数据与云计算的结合

大数据分析需要大量的计算资源,云计算提供了这种资源。研究方向包括:

  • 数据存储优化:研究如何高效地存储和管理大数据。
  • 数据分析算法:开发新的算法,以加速大数据的处理和分析。

二、创新点

1. 自动化与智能化

云计算自动化和智能化是当前的一个重要趋势。通过自动化工具和人工智能技术,可以更高效地管理云资源。

2. 微服务架构

微服务架构将应用程序分解为小型、独立的服务,这些服务可以独立部署和扩展。这种架构提高了系统的可维护性和可扩展性。

3. 边缘计算

边缘计算将数据处理和存储推向网络边缘,以减少延迟和提高响应速度。

三、挑战

1. 安全性问题

云计算的安全性问题一直是关注的焦点。如何确保数据的安全性和隐私性,防止网络攻击,是云计算面临的重要挑战。

2. 跨云互操作性

随着多云环境的普及,如何实现不同云平台之间的互操作性,是一个亟待解决的问题。

3. 网络延迟

在分布式云环境中,网络延迟可能会影响应用程序的性能。如何优化网络架构,减少延迟,是云计算研究的一个重要方向。

四、结论

云计算的未来充满了无限可能,同时也面临着诸多挑战。通过不断创新和突破,云计算将继续推动信息技术的发展,为企业和社会带来更多价值。